Customer Reviews and Ratings of Car Insurance Companies: Your Insightful Guide

When it comes to choosing the right car insurance, you’re not alone in your decision. Customer reviews and ratings offer valuable insights into how an insurance company performs in real-world scenarios. Here’s a concise rundown of why these reviews matter and how to interpret them:

1. Authentic Experiences

  • Customer reviews reflect real experiences with insurance companies.
  • Gain insight into the company’s claim process, customer service, and more.

2. Claims Handling

  • Reviews shed light on how quickly and efficiently claims are processed.
  • Understand the company’s responsiveness in times of need.

3. Customer Service

  • Discover how helpful and responsive the company’s customer service is.
  • Assess how well they handle inquiries and concerns.

4. Pricing Transparency

  • Reviews might mention whether the pricing matches the quoted rates.
  • Get an idea of whether there are hidden fees or unexpected changes.

5. Coverage Satisfaction

  • Understand how satisfied customers are with the coverage options.
  • Learn if policyholders feel adequately protected.

6. Online Tools and Technology

  • Reviews might highlight the user-friendliness of online tools.
  • Determine if the company offers convenient digital services.

7. Long-Term Satisfaction

  • Look for reviews from long-term policyholders.
  • This indicates whether the company’s service remains consistent over time.

8. Pros and Cons

  • Reviews often outline both positive and negative experiences.
  • Evaluate if the pros align with your priorities and the cons are manageable.

9. Diverse Perspectives

  • Read a variety of reviews to capture different perspectives.
  • This helps you form a well-rounded opinion.

10. Your Decision Guide

  • Use customer reviews and ratings as one factor in your decision-making.
  • Combine these insights with other research for a comprehensive choice. 

Remember, no single review should dictate your decision. Treat reviews as a helpful tool alongside other considerations to find the car insurance company that best fits your needs.
